Polo vs Lavras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Polo, Dominican Republic and Lavras, Brazil is approximately 5,225 km or 3,247 mi.
  • To reach Polo in this distance one would set out from Lavras bearing 324.9°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Polo bearing 325.7° or NW .
  • Polo has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) whereas Lavras has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a).
  • Both are in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 1.9 °C (3.5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.5 °C (6.3°F) less in Polo.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 344.9 mm (13.6 in) more which is equivalent to 344.9 l/m² (8.46 US gal/ft²) or 3,449,000 l/ha (368,721 US gal/ac) more. About 1 2/9 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 2.9° higher in Polo than in Lavras.
  • Relative humidity levels are 10.5%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 3.9°C (7°F) higher.
